logo

深度解析DeepSeek:AI大语言模型的技术突破与应用实践

作者:rousong2025.09.26 20:02浏览量:0

简介:本文深入解析AI大语言模型DeepSeek的核心架构、技术优势及行业应用,通过理论分析与案例实践,为开发者与企业提供技术选型与优化策略的实用指南。

一、DeepSeek:AI大语言模型的技术定位与演进背景

在AI大语言模型(LLM)领域,DeepSeek凭借其独特的架构设计与技术创新,成为近年来备受关注的研究成果。与传统模型(如GPT系列、BERT)相比,DeepSeek的核心定位在于高效语义理解低资源场景下的高性能输出,尤其适用于需要快速响应、高精度推理的实时应用场景。

1.1 技术演进背景

AI大语言模型的发展经历了三个阶段:

  1. 规则驱动阶段(2010年前):依赖人工定义的语法规则,处理简单语义任务;
  2. 统计驱动阶段(2010-2018):基于N-gram、词向量等技术,实现初步语义关联;
  3. 神经驱动阶段(2018年至今):以Transformer架构为核心,通过自监督学习实现上下文感知。

DeepSeek的诞生正是基于第三阶段的技术积累,其创新点在于动态注意力机制多模态融合架构,解决了传统模型在长文本处理、多任务适配中的效率瓶颈。

二、DeepSeek的核心技术架构解析

2.1 动态注意力机制(Dynamic Attention)

传统Transformer模型采用固定位置的注意力计算,导致长文本处理时计算复杂度呈平方级增长。DeepSeek通过引入动态注意力权重分配,实现了以下优化:

  1. # 动态注意力权重计算示例(伪代码)
  2. def dynamic_attention(query, key, value, context_window):
  3. # 基于上下文窗口动态调整注意力范围
  4. attn_weights = softmax((query @ key.T) / sqrt(key.shape[-1]))
  5. # 引入局部敏感哈希(LSH)加速计算
  6. lsh_buckets = locality_sensitive_hashing(query, key)
  7. dynamic_mask = generate_mask(lsh_buckets, context_window)
  8. return (attn_weights * dynamic_mask) @ value

技术优势

  • 计算复杂度从O(n²)降至O(n log n);
  • 在保持长距离依赖捕捉能力的同时,减少无效计算。

2.2 多模态融合架构

DeepSeek支持文本、图像、音频的多模态输入,其融合策略采用跨模态注意力桥接(Cross-Modal Attention Bridge):

  1. 独立编码:通过模态专用编码器(如ResNet-50用于图像、BiLSTM用于音频)提取特征;
  2. 桥接层对齐:使用可学习的投影矩阵将不同模态特征映射至共享语义空间;
  3. 联合解码:通过多头注意力机制实现模态间信息交互。

应用场景

  • 医疗影像报告生成(输入CT图像,输出诊断文本);
  • 智能客服中的语音-文本双向交互。

2.3 轻量化部署技术

针对边缘设备部署需求,DeepSeek采用以下优化:

  1. 模型蒸馏:通过知识蒸馏将大模型(如175B参数)压缩至轻量版(如7B参数),精度损失<3%;
  2. 量化压缩:支持INT8量化,模型体积减少75%,推理速度提升2倍;
  3. 动态批处理:根据请求负载自动调整批处理大小,平衡延迟与吞吐量。

三、DeepSeek的行业应用实践

3.1 金融领域:智能投研助手

某头部券商部署DeepSeek后,实现了以下功能:

  • 实时财报解析:输入上市公司年报PDF,3秒内生成结构化摘要与风险点标注;
  • 舆情监控:抓取社交媒体、新闻数据,预测股价波动概率(准确率达82%);
  • 代码生成:根据自然语言描述自动生成Python量化策略(示例如下):
    1. # DeepSeek生成的均线交叉策略
    2. def moving_average_crossover(data, short_window=5, long_window=20):
    3. short_ma = data['close'].rolling(window=short_window).mean()
    4. long_ma = data['close'].rolling(window=long_window).mean()
    5. signals = pd.DataFrame(index=data.index)
    6. signals['signal'] = 0.0
    7. signals['signal'][short_window:] = np.where(
    8. short_ma[short_window:] > long_ma[short_window:], 1.0, 0.0)
    9. signals['positions'] = signals['signal'].diff()
    10. return signals

3.2 医疗领域:辅助诊断系统

在某三甲医院的实践中,DeepSeek实现了:

  • 电子病历智能审核:自动检测医嘱与诊断的逻辑矛盾(召回率91%);
  • 医学文献检索:支持自然语言查询,返回相关论文与临床指南片段;
  • 多模态诊断:结合患者主诉、检查报告与影像数据,生成鉴别诊断列表。

3.3 制造业:设备故障预测

某汽车工厂利用DeepSeek构建预测性维护系统:

  1. 数据采集:整合振动传感器、温度日志等时序数据;
  2. 特征工程:通过DeepSeek的时序编码模块提取异常模式;
  3. 预测模型:输出设备故障概率与建议维护时间窗。
    实施效果:设备停机时间减少40%,维护成本降低25%。

四、开发者指南:DeepSeek的集成与优化

4.1 快速入门步骤

  1. 环境配置
    1. # 使用Docker部署(推荐)
    2. docker pull deepseek/llm-base:latest
    3. docker run -d -p 8080:8080 deepseek/llm-base
  2. API调用示例
    1. import requests
    2. response = requests.post(
    3. "http://localhost:8080/v1/completions",
    4. json={
    5. "model": "deepseek-7b",
    6. "prompt": "解释量子纠缠现象",
    7. "max_tokens": 200
    8. }
    9. )
    10. print(response.json()["choices"][0]["text"])

4.2 性能优化策略

  1. 批处理优化
    • 合并多个短请求为长请求,减少网络开销;
    • 动态调整batch_size参数(建议范围:8-32)。
  2. 缓存机制
    • 对高频查询(如天气、股票)建立本地缓存;
    • 使用LRU算法管理缓存空间。
  3. 硬件加速
    • 优先使用NVIDIA A100/H100 GPU;
    • 启用TensorRT加速推理(性能提升30%)。

4.3 常见问题解决方案

问题现象 可能原因 解决方案
推理延迟高 模型未量化 启用INT8量化模式
输出重复 温度参数过低 调整temperature至0.7-1.0
内存溢出 批处理过大 减少batch_size或启用交换空间

五、未来展望:DeepSeek的技术演进方向

  1. 实时学习框架:支持在线增量训练,适应数据分布变化;
  2. 因果推理模块:增强模型对因果关系的理解能力;
  3. 隐私保护机制:集成联邦学习与差分隐私技术。

结语:DeepSeek作为新一代AI大语言模型,通过动态注意力、多模态融合与轻量化部署等技术创新,为金融、医疗、制造等行业提供了高效、可靠的智能解决方案。开发者可通过本文提供的实践指南,快速实现模型集成与性能优化,把握AI技术落地的关键机遇。

相关文章推荐

发表评论

活动